Hack Nights provide an opportunity for students to focus solely on building. In four-hour power sessions, students gather, share ideas, and get to work building (whether they’re coding, prototyping, designing, or imagining). At the end, students share what they’ve been working on. The only rule: “no homework”. Students aren’t compelled to continue working on their projects, but they just might discover their great new idea or find that awesome, complementarily skilled co-founder they’ve been looking for.
